Chinaunix

标题: 如何移除FreeBSD Boot Manager ? [打印本页]

作者: lxdme    时间: 2005-07-11 17:03
标题: 如何移除FreeBSD Boot Manager ?
系统:FreeBSD 5.4-RELEASE
不小心安装了FreeBSD Boot Manager,现想改用standard MBR (no boot manager)  模式启动,该如何移除FreeBSD Boot Manager ?

试过dos环境下执行 A:\>; fdisk /mbr 重启开机后仍然出现FreeBSD Boot Manager 的提示符
F1         Freebsd

Default: F1
作者: 剑心通明    时间: 2005-07-11 17:26
标题: 如何移除FreeBSD Boot Manager ?
你说的是命令提示符吧?用98的启动盘进去fdisk/mbr吧
作者: lxdme    时间: 2005-07-11 17:52
标题: 如何移除FreeBSD Boot Manager ?
[quote]原帖由 "剑心通明"]你说的是命令提示符吧?用98的启动盘进去fdisk/mbr吧[/quote 发表:


兄弟,当然是用98的启动盘进去fdisk/mbr的,就只装了一个FreeBSD系统,没有Win环境,哪儿来的“命令提示符”啊,就算是有也是FreeBSD的shell提示符,你见过有在FreeBSdxia下这么敲命令的吗?A:\>; fdisk /mbr
作者: congli    时间: 2005-07-11 23:20
标题: 如何移除FreeBSD Boot Manager ?
看看这个行不:
man boot0cfg
作者: 剑心通明    时间: 2005-07-12 08:26
标题: 如何移除FreeBSD Boot Manager ?
我以为你是双系统哪,98的启动盘fdisk/mbr以后应该可以的啊,我以前试过的啊
作者: lxdme    时间: 2005-07-12 11:50
标题: 如何移除FreeBSD Boot Manager ?
原帖由 "congli" 发表:
看看这个行不:
man boot0cfg


BSDsrv# man boot0cfg

看过之后好像没有关于卸载FreeBSD Boot Manager的选项,有一个选项好像是安装Boot Manager,但没有卸载功能啊
_____________________________________________________
# NAME
boot0cfg -- boot manager installation/configuration utility

# SYNOPSIS
boot0cfg [-Bv] [-b boot0] [-d drive] [-f file] [-m mask] [-o options]
              [-s slice] [-t ticks] disk

# options
-B      Install the `boot0' boot manager.  This option causes MBR code to  be replaced, without affecting the embedded slice table.
_____________________________________________________
根据以上语法敲入如下命令
BSDsrv# boot0cfg -Bv da0
重启后依然如旧,还是出现FreeBSD Boot Manager提示符
作者: ruf    时间: 2005-07-12 12:52
标题: 如何移除FreeBSD Boot Manager ?
既然fdisk/mbr都没有用,说明你的freebsd boot manager安装在分区里面了,没有影响MBR,MBR就是标准的。

你的机器又没有其他OS,如果没有boot manager,怎么启动freebsd?
作者: kgnn    时间: 2005-07-12 16:50
标题: 如何移除FreeBSD Boot Manager ?
只装了一个FreeBSD系统,为什么要执著的移除FreeBSD Boot Manager
如果要装其它系统,用其它Boot Manager进行多重系统引导,装上就是了

往往都是直接在MBR装其它Boot Manager覆盖掉原来的,没听说过只有一个系统却非要移除FreeBSD Boot Manager   
当然,要先作好准备,知道怎么用新的Boot Manager引导FreeBSD
作者: gsging    时间: 2005-07-12 17:53
标题: 如何移除FreeBSD Boot Manager ?
原帖由 "ruf" 发表:
既然fdisk/mbr都没有用,说明你的freebsd boot manager安装在分区里面了,没有影响MBR,MBR就是标准的。

你的机器又没有其他OS,如果没有boot manager,怎么启动freebsd?

没有bootmanager一样可以起系统。boot manager只是一个manager并不是mbr。
作者: ruf    时间: 2005-07-12 18:33
标题: 如何移除FreeBSD Boot Manager ?
原帖由 "gsging" 发表:

没有bootmanager一样可以起系统。boot manager只是一个manager并不是mbr。


当然你安装grub也可以,不过一台只安装有freebsd的机器,好像没什么理由不使用boot manager。
作者: gsging    时间: 2005-07-12 19:46
标题: 如何移除FreeBSD Boot Manager ?
原帖由 "ruf" 发表:


当然你安装grub也可以,不过一台只安装有freebsd的机器,好像没什么理由不使用boot manager。


我认为一台只装fb的机器好象没什么理由使用boot manager.
hehe.

难道兄台在单机装bsd的时候都不选
install a standard mbr(no bootmanager)
这个选项么?
作者: congli    时间: 2005-07-12 22:26
标题: 如何移除FreeBSD Boot Manager ?
原帖由 "gsging" 发表:


我认为一台只装fb的机器好象没什么理由使用boot manager.
hehe.

难道兄台在单机装bsd的时候都不选
install a standard mbr(no bootmanager)
这个选项么?

正解,只有一个系统(FreeBSD)时,的确不需要装BM.
install a standard mbr(no bootmanager)
这个选项就可以了.
作者: 剑心通明    时间: 2005-07-13 08:23
标题: 如何移除FreeBSD Boot Manager ?
而且大多数都是把FB作服务器的,一般都是一个机器就一个系统吧
作者: sandro.c    时间: 2005-07-13 08:37
标题: 如何移除FreeBSD Boot Manager ?
这个问题我也碰到过了,不过最后解决方法恐怕是让人大跌眼镜,不知道为什么,如果选择了安装Boot Manager,FreeBSD现在会将自己所在的分区设为活动分区,哈哈,就是这样,我就是用98的启动盘启动后,使用fdisk将活动分区改回来的,光fdisk /mbr是没有任何作用的。
作者: ruf    时间: 2005-07-13 10:38
标题: 如何移除FreeBSD Boot Manager ?
原帖由 "gsging" 发表:


我认为一台只装fb的机器好象没什么理由使用boot manager.
hehe.

难道兄台在单机装bsd的时候都不选
install a standard mbr(no bootmanager)
这个选项么?


u right.  

我本只想说安装BM不一定影响MBR。

去除BM的方法:

安装光盘启动,sysinstall中,进入Index ->; FDisk
选择你想boot的分区,按'S'激活,然后按'W'存盘
sysinstall会问你安装哪个bootmanager,选择standard就可以了。
然后Exit Installation,Reboot,就可以了。
作者: 黑夜编码人    时间: 2005-07-16 02:21
标题: 如何移除FreeBSD Boot Manager ?
# boot0cfg -B -b /boot/mbr




欢迎光临 Chinaunix (http://bbs.chinaunix.net/) Powered by Discuz! X3.2